Hanukkah Inspired Cupcake Wrappers

Brighten up your holiday celebration with these cheerful yet simple Hanukkah inspired cupcake wrappers. These can be printed on any type of paper measuring 8- 1/2×11. I typically use card stock  because it is sturdier, but regular old printing paper can be used as well.
